Headquarters · Primary Hub
Townsville
Our headquarters and the geotechnical epicentre of NQ. The region's geology ranges from soft reactive estuarine clays on the coastal plain to weathered granite and metamorphic basement rocks of the adjacent ranges. PGI has completed hundreds of investigations here — residential site classifications, commercial foundation investigations, slope stability assessments and major infrastructure projects.
Burdekin Region
Ayr & the Burdekin
The Burdekin delta presents some of Queensland's most geotechnically challenging soils — highly reactive black clays with extreme shrink-swell behaviour that devastates residential slabs and infrastructure if not properly characterised. PGI has extensive experience with Burdekin reactive soils, providing AS 2870 classifications, reactive soil assessments and foundation design guidance.
Whitsunday Region
Bowen & Whitsunday
Bowen's coastal geology — weathered rock headlands, estuarine sediments and coastal sand deposits — requires careful geotechnical assessment for any development. PGI provides geotechnical investigation, site classification and earthworks services across the Bowen and Whitsunday region, supporting residential development, port infrastructure and major industrial projects.
Hinchinbrook Region
Ingham & Hinchinbrook
The Hinchinbrook region's high-rainfall landscape is underlain by complex geotechnical conditions — deep alluvial profiles, saturated coastal clays and steep mountain terrain subject to rainfall-triggered landsliding. PGI brings specialist slope stability and ground investigation expertise to the Ingham area, supporting local government infrastructure, residential development and agricultural projects.
Cassowary Coast Region
Cardwell & Cassowary Coast
The Cassowary Coast sits at the interface of ancient wet tropics ranges and a narrow coastal plain — creating geotechnical conditions characterised by variable, often shallow rock profiles interspersed with deep pockets of soft marine and alluvial sediment. PGI provides foundation investigation, site classification and slope stability services for residential, tourism and infrastructure projects in the area.
Northern Highlands
Charters Towers & Northern Highlands
The Charters Towers region occupies the transitional geological zone between the ancient basement rocks of the Townsville hinterland and the sedimentary sequences of the inland basins. Granitic and metamorphic bedrock — often relatively shallow — creates both sound bearing capacity and excavation challenges. PGI's engineering geology expertise is particularly valuable in this region.
Flinders Region
Hughenden & the Flinders
The Flinders region's predominantly flat terrain belies the geotechnical complexity beneath — variable alluvial profiles, reactive clay soils, and limited access to specialist engineering services. PGI mobilises to Hughenden and the broader Flinders Shire to support local government infrastructure programs, water supply projects and private development.
North West Queensland
Mount Isa & North West QLD
Mount Isa sits at the geological heart of one of the world's great mining provinces — the ancient Precambrian Mount Isa Inlier. Strong, competent basement rocks with complex fault and joint systems, highly variable weathering profiles and shallow rock depths in many areas make this a technically demanding environment. PGI provides geotechnical investigation, engineering geology and ground investigation for mining infrastructure, residential and town projects.
Gulf Country
Burketown & Gulf Country
The Gulf Country's extensive black soil plains — highly reactive Vertosols — present severe foundation challenges that have caused significant distress to infrastructure built without adequate geotechnical assessment. PGI mobilises to the Gulf Country for local government infrastructure renewal, remote community housing and growing tourism and pastoral development projects.
Isaac Region
Moranbah & Isaac Region
Moranbah and the broader Isaac Region are defined by the Bowen Basin — one of Australia's premier metallurgical coal-producing regions with major infrastructure investment. The Basin's gently dipping sedimentary sequences require specialist geotechnical assessment for mining infrastructure, town development and the growing renewable energy sector. PGI provides geotechnical investigation and engineering geology across the Isaac Region.
